The s.ky blue team prides itself on the highly flexible AWARE or Automated Weather Adaptive Response Energy control system that is being developed as part of a research project at the University of Kentucky. This system is an accessible and easy-to-use control system that makes it possible to meet the occupants desired comfort level. The system has been designed so customizing your home for your needs is possible. The control system’s computer interface allows the user to view and analyze their energy consumption. It displays the circuits and items consuming energy to promote awareness and alert the occupants of practices that waste energy so they can partner with their home in the conservation effort. The key component of the AWARE control system is its ability to read a zip-code specific weather forecast 3 to 6 hours in advance. It then simulates the various ways of operating the house systems based upon the weather forecast and picks the optimal mode of operation.
